2 Power Assist Brake problem of the 1997 Ford Explorer

Failure Date: 08/25/1999

Lost power assist to braking system during freeway rush hour. No warning of loss of power brakes. Almost unable to stop in time. Lost of power assist traced to loss of motor vacuum due to air filter clogged with auto transmission fluid. Filter recieved auto trans oil from transmission fluid leaking from oil cooler. See service bulletin number 99-4-6, bulletin sequence number 477, date 9903, NHTSA item number sb60476. Dealer says service bulletin does not indicate that air filter should be checked when repairing leak or that a clogged air filter can lead to loss of power assist to breaks. Also note that the antilock breaking system will not work without the power assist.

3 Power Assist Brake problem of the 2000 Ford Explorer

The brake booster fails intermittently and causes an approximate 90% loss of braking power. The pedal is high and firm but no braking power. The effect is the same as when the brakes are pumped with the engine off causing a loss of vacuum and power assist. It does no occur when the dealer service tested the vehicle so no fix as yet.
